Transaction e16ab701b17966f908ebd55f4084bc84fe1a1509e54c36e00d51f07af72f67ea
1 Input
1 Output
-
e16ab701b17966f908ebd55f4084bc84fe1a1509e54c36e00d51f07af72f67ea:0
- value
- 1566433
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6b028589795ddb378809eb527ac9b4363f64c7b2 OP_EQUAL
- address
- 3BSqFGvtzaqXE29CcrsJAy4gGd2Qf1LeDD